I'm sorry for asking a really newbie question here.  But I'm just 
missing something I guess.  I've read the HOWTO for 3.0.0 and either I 
missed it or I just didn't understand it.

I have 3.0.1Pre1 on RH 9 "Machine A" working as a domain controller with 
a win2000 SP4 box.  I made a USB local CUPS printer on RH 9 "Machine B". 
  I made a remote CUPS printer on "A" that prints to "B" just fine.  How 
do I get the Win2000 machine "C" to print to the printer on "B"? I can 
see the printer share from Win2000.  I can't connect to it though, it 
says I have insufficient access.  I try to create a "network" printer 
and use \\Machine A\dot but again insufficient access.  I'm logged in as 
root on the win2k box, in the TESTDOM domain. I also don't understand 
what parameter to put into smb.conf to actually print to the CUPS 
printer.  What am I missing here?  How do you add the printer from the 
Windows side?  Or do you just connect to it?  My samba.log shows this 
when trying to connect:

[2003/11/03 23:58:26, 0] smbd/service.c:set_admin_user(321)
   root logged in as admin user (root privileges)
[2003/11/03 23:58:27, 0] printing/print_cups.c:cups_queue_get(889)
   Unable to get jobs for ipp://localhost/printers/dot - 
client-error-not-found

Here is my smb.conf for printing:

[global]

         workgroup = TESTDOM
         netbios name = blue
         security = user
         server string = Samba Server
         printcap name = /etc/printcap
         load printers = yes

         log file = /var/log/samba.log
         log level = 2
         max log size = 50000
         add machine script = /usr/sbin/useradd -n -g machines -c 
Machine -d /dev /null -s /bin/false %u
         add user script = /usr/sbin/useradd %u

         socket options = TCP_NODELAY SO_RCVBUF=8192 SO_SNDBUF=8192

         local master = Yes
         os level = 65
         domain master = yes
         preferred master = yes
         domain logons = yes
         admin users = root
         csc policy = disable
         logon script = logon.bat
         logon path = \\%L\profiles\%U
         logon drive = H:
         printing = cups
         printcap name = cups

  [printers]
         comment = All Printers
         path = /var/spool/samba
         browseable = no
         # Set public = yes to allow user 'guest account' to print
         guest ok = yes
         writable = yes
         public = yes
         printable = yes
         printer admin = root, douglas

[dot]
         comment = Printer with Restricted Access
         path = /var/spool/samba_my_printer
         printer admin = root, douglas
         browseable = yes
         printable = yes
         writeable = yes
         guest ok = yes
